Chickenpox Testing is a diagnostic test used to detect the varicella-zoster virus (VZV), which causes chickenpox. Chickenpox is a highly contagious viral infection characterized by itchy, red spots and blisters all over the body. Chickenpox Testing is important for confirming the diagnosis, especially in cases with atypical symptoms, and for guiding appropriate medical management.
If you reside in Delaware, Ohio, and have symptoms suggestive of chickenpox, such as fever, headache, and a rash that progresses to itchy blisters, Chickenpox Testing is recommended. Testing is also valuable for individuals with a history of exposure to someone with chickenpox to assess their immunity status.

The interpretation of Chickenpox Testing results involves assessing the presence of VZV-specific antibodies in the blood. Positive results for VZV IgM indicate a recent or active infection, while positive results for VZV IgG indicate immunity due to past infection or vaccination.

After Chickenpox Testing, healthcare providers discuss the results with individuals and provide guidance on managing the infection and preventing its transmission to others. Vaccination may be recommended for susceptible individuals to prevent future chickenpox infections.
